Bird has these listed on ebay and titled as "S 9068 blacksmith tool".  I have an idea what it is.  But I don't think it is blacksmith made - because smithy tools are not usually number stamped (or so I think).  I am guessing these are brake spring pliers.  I'm visualizing the hooked end of the spring fitting in the slot end of the tool and being pulled onto its post by the pointed hook end which sometimes would grab onto the brake lining.
Maybe it will help to sell if we can identify.
